This workshop will give participants a theoretical context to group work and will focus on the practical skills needed to work with children and young people in group situations.  The workshop will have a mixture of presentations, discussions & experimental learning opportunities.

Participants will be give the opportunity to:

  • Develop a knowledge of group work processes
  • Develop skills in group facilitation
  • Prepare, plan and design sessions
  • Manage Conflict and Difficulties
  • Assess and Evaluate the Group Work Processes
  • Evaluate their own performance
